Force India open up wheel fairing for extra cooling

Indexed: Fri Oct 10, 2008 @ 12:00:11AM 2 months 4 weeks ago
Force India have only recently come up with their wheel fairings, but are already heavily experimenting with them. While the initial version very much resembled that of Red Bull, the Singapore circuit required modifications to make sure the front brakes are adequately cooled. The 'hot-spec' version is basically a half fairing, as it only covers half of the wheel. Due to the nature of the remaining circuits though, it appears unlikely that the team will use this version again as more optimal versions are possible, without doubt.
